Output 105228007569fd23fcbbaddd4b1f436f2611c52a3a30ac8da11e668783f18ced:108

value
259272
script pubkey
OP_0 OP_PUSHBYTES_20 b84ef4a6824a9c58fb6a554727d0e337da8bcbf6
address
bc1qhp80ff5zf2w937m224rj058rxldghjlk4nxnx7
transaction
105228007569fd23fcbbaddd4b1f436f2611c52a3a30ac8da11e668783f18ced